How does the cleanliness of an aircraft affect its performance?

The cleanliness of an aircraft directly impacts its performance primarily due to the aerodynamics involved. When an aircraft is dirty, it accumulates contaminants such as dirt, oil, and grease on its surfaces, which can disrupt the smooth airflow over the wings and fuselage. This disruption increases drag and can lead to a decrease in overall lift and efficiency. Consequently, a dirty aircraft may underperform compared to performance charts that are based on clean aircraft data.
